Marine Engineer Southampton £32,000 - £35,000 + Overtime + Excellent Company Benefits

Do you have Marine Engineering experience, looking for on the job training, long term job security and plenty of overtime to increase your earnings? This is an excellent opportunity to join a renowned business who will invest in your development and allow you to work on specialist equipment. The company is growing and expanding its engineering workforce due to high demand for its products. The role is split between the workshop and client sites, with some international travel involved.

Responsibilities
  • Workshop and field based work on niche equipment
  • Plenty of overtime opportunities
Qualifications & Attributes
  • Marine engineering background
  • Happy to travel
  • Looking for training
